The POLITICO project has parterned with 24 organisations and institutions.
These partnerships allow, where appropriate our Early Stage Researchers (ESRs) the opportunity to conduct field research while on placement.
During their placement the ESRs will have full access to the facilities of the partner institution where they are conducting this field research, along with an on-site expert to keep them on track in their PhD, while continuing to be being supervised by their University of Aberdeen supervisors.
